Acute disorder characterized by bilateral lung infiltrates and severe progressive hypoxemia in the absence of any evidence of cardiogenic pulmonary edema within 7 days of an inciting event.

Abnormal accumulation of extravascular fluid in the lung parenchyma.
Widespread axonal damage in the aftermath of acute/repetitive traumatic brain injury (TBI), leading to deficits in cerebral connectivity that may or may not recover over time.
Hyperglycemic crisis is a metabolic emergency associated with uncontrolled diabetes mellitus that may result in significant morbidity or death.
